Sublime Text 3 — установить обычный текст по умолчанию на Java

Мне нужен тип файла возвышенного текста 3 по умолчанию от «Обычный текст» до Java. Я попытался установить пакет из github(), создав новую настройку default_file_type, а затем установив:

{
    "default_new_file_syntax": "Packages/Java.sublime-settings",
    "use_current_file_syntax": true
}

Но пока не повезло. Я думаю, что пакет работает для версии 2.

Любые идеи?


person BestCoderEver    schedule 18.12.2014    source источник


Ответы (1)


Вы почти правильно поняли. Правильная настройка должна быть:

{
    "default_new_file_syntax": "Packages/Java/Java.tmLanguage",
    "use_current_file_syntax": true
}

Вам необходимо указать путь к файлу синтаксиса фактического языка (.tmLanguage). Кроме того, если вы не знали, параметр "use_current_file_syntax" означает, что если вы открыли файл с определенным синтаксисом и нажали CtrlN, чтобы открыть новый файл, этот новый файл будет использовать синтаксис ранее открытого файла, не обязательно Java. Если вы хотите, чтобы все новые файлы имели синтаксис Java, установите "use_current_file_syntax": false.

person MattDMo    schedule 18.12.2014